Comprehending House Locks
House locks are gadgets developed to secure windows and doors, avoiding unapproved gain access to. They are available in different designs and performances, each serving unique functions. Below are the main types of locks typically used in residential settings:
1. Deadbolt Locks
Deadbolt locks are one of the most safe kinds of locks available. They feature a strong metal bolt that extends into the doorframe, making it nearly difficult to force open.

Keys are an important part of any locking system. They are designed to fit particular locks, therefore making it possible for users to operate them safely. There are numerous kinds of secrets to consider:
1. Conventional Metal Keys
These are the most common kind of secrets. They are made from metal and suit the lock system to disengage the bolt.
2. Transponder Keys
These keys consist of a microchip that interacts with an electronic lock. They are frequently utilized in modern lorries but are finding their method into residential security as well.
3. Smart Keys
Comparable to transponder keys, clever keys do not require inserting into a lock. Rather, they run through proximity sensors, allowing doors to unlock automatically when within range.
4. Skeleton Keys
Historically utilized in older locks, skeleton keys can run several locks. Though they are not commonly utilized in modern residential settings, they still exist in antique locks.
